Viewing Picture-in-Picture
One of the most best features of your TV is the Picture-in-Picture (PIP) feature. The advanced PIP
system allows you to watch two different pictures at once, even if you don’t have a VCR connect-
ed to your TV.
Selecting a PIP Screen
1
Press the Menu button. Move
the joystick down to select PIP,
then press the joystick to
enter.
Quick way to access PIP:
Just press “PIP” on the remote
control.
2
Move the joystick right to
select PIP “On”. The PIP
image will appear in the
corner of the screen.
3
Press Menu to exit.
NOTES
• Picture-in-Picture doesn’t function when the V-chip is active.
• If you turn the TV off while watching and turn it on again, then the mode will return to normal
video.
• Screen size can’t be changed in the PIP mode.
